VIDEO β© President Alar Karis: I hope our country reflects the face of young and educated people
President Alar Karis expressed his hope that Estonia will reflect the perspectives of young and educated individuals during a press interaction.
In a recent press interaction held at the Estonia concert hall, President Alar Karis highlighted his vision for the future of Estonia, focusing on the importance of youth and education. He articulated his belief that the future of the country lies in the hands of the young generation, who are not only growing up quickly but will also bring new perspectives as they come of age. Karis emphasized the dynamic nature of youth, stating that while current young people are maturing, fresh young voices will soon emerge to take their place.
Karis further elaborated on the role of education in shaping the country's identity, suggesting that a nation should also represent educated individuals. He underscored the connection between a youthful population and the nation's progress, indicating that education plays a critical role in fostering a society that not only values youth but also invests in their development.
